Jen Hamilton

Children's Ministry Leader

Jen Hamilton is a Rapid City, South Dakota native whose life is deeply rooted in her faith and family. A devoted follower of Jesus since 2010, Jen deepened her theological foundation in 2013 by completing the Horizon School of Evangelism program in San Diego, California. Today, she channels her passion for scripture into her role as a serious student of the Bible and a dedicated servant at Landmark Community Church. Since 2022, Jen has joyfully served in the Children’s Ministry, where she combines her love for children with her gift for teaching, helping the next generation understand and grow in the Word of God.

Outside of her ministry work, Jen’s heart belongs completely to her family and her vibrant church community. She is happily married to her husband, Dustin and they are raising their two sons ,Jeb and Turner. Whether she is cheering on her sons, investing time in her family, or studying scripture, Jen approaches every area of her life with warmth, purpose, and a desire to serve others.

Darla Zechiel 

Children's Ministry Co-Leader

For most of her life, Rapid City has been home to Darla Zechiel. Since giving her heart to Jesus in 1996, her life has been defined by a deep desire to help others experience God's love. Over the past four years, she and her husband, Cliff, have become familiar, welcoming faces at Landmark Community Church, where they team up to serve in the Children’s Ministry. Darla is passionate about teaching the Bible to young hearts, ensuring every child feels loved, valued, and encouraged.

Though she is now retired from her career, Darla is as active as ever in her calling. She spends her days serving others through the joys of faith, church life, and her family. Above all, she treasures her role as a mother to her son and a grandmother to her two grandchildren, whom she adores completely.
